Instead of finding some magic formula online, get a backtest tool, try multiple options an see the statistics. For example, backtest last few months with 0.5 ATR SL, 1 ATR CL, 1.5 ATR SL etc and see that are the results. Of course, past results does not guarantee future results, but at least you will probably see some configurations that are completely useless. Much better than trying to decode some magic formula without understanding what could be real trading results with that.
